2. Indie Rock
Well known Indie Rock Artists:
Arctic Monkeys
Modest Mouse
The Strokes
MGMT
The Killers
Two Door Cinema Club
The main conventions you would see in an indie rock video are either a band playing
on location, or a story been told which is taken from the lyrics not involving any
member of the band. You wouldn’t expect bright colours or complete, solid blacks, it
would tend to be low tones of colours or pale ones. It is also seen as ‘alternative rock’
which influences their quirky videos reflecting their audience’s alternative and
different tastes in music.
3. R&B
Well known R&B artists:
Beyonce
Rihanna
Jay-z
Lil Wayne
Usher
Drake
Kanye West
In an R&B video you would expect to see the artist surrounded by either other artists
or groups of their opposite gender. In a male’s video, you would expect to see girls in
very few clothes dancing. However, in a female video, they tend to dance with
backing dancers. They are usually on location in the sun or around a pool or party
with signs of alcohol and drugs; this tends to be because their audience are similar to
them and share the same interests of a ‘party life’. Furthermore, we would expect to
see expensive items such as jewellery, clothes, cars and houses.
4. Dubstep
Well known dubstep artists:
Skrillex
Skream
Flux Pavilion
Modestep
Borgore
Datsik
Dubstep videos tend to have a scenes of crime and violence with dark lighting and
scarce locations. Skrillex – Bangarang, for example, features children robbing an
ice cream man and, after growing up, step up and rob a bank. However, they are
good-feel at the end of the videos, as they are supposed to be uplifting stories.

6. Electronic Dance
Well known electronic dance artists:
Example
Nero
The Progidy
Chase and Status
Sub Focus
David Guetta
Calvin Harris
The videos feature a lot of strobe lighting and dance scenes mainly on a live set with a
crowd at i.e. a concert or festival. It reflects the audience as it is jumpy and the audience
would dance to it therefore the video contains people dancing and raving expressing
their happiness like the song itself does. On the other hand, it can contain women in
provocative clothing around fast, expensive race cars. Conventions of electronic dance
is high paced editing which has a high contrast between light and dark.
